Misserio
Misserio is a village in Santa Teresa di Riva, Messina, Sicily and has about 375 residents. Misserio is situated nearby to the hamlet Chiesanuova, as well as near Fautari.Places of Interest

Santi Pietro e Paolo d’Agrò
Church
Photo: Ludvig14,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Santi Pietro e Paolo d’Agrò is a church in Casalvecchio Siculo, in the Metropolitan City of Messina on Sicily. It is one of the foremost examples on Sicily of Norman architecture. Santi Pietro e Paolo d’Agrò is situated 3½ km south of Misserio.
